The bibscrap package provides semi-automated tools for systematic literature reviews.
- Python 3.8+
To install Bibscrap, use one of the commands below:
| Package Manager | Install Command |
|---|---|
pip |
pip install --pre bibscrap |
pipenv |
pipenv install --pre bibscrap |
poetry |
poetry add --allow-prerelease bibscrap |

To download the development version of bibscrap and install its dependencies into a virtual environment, follow the instructions provided below:
$ git clone https://github.com/cotterell/bibscrap.git $ cd bibscrap $ poetry install -E devtools -E docs
To activate the virtual environment, use the following command:
$ poetry shell
If you are part of the bibscrap development team, then you should also install the pre-commit hooks once your virtual environment is activated. You only need to do this once. Here is the command:
$ pre-commit install
